The Rise Of One-Club Fan Media
The emergence of one-club fan media has created a dedicated space for supporters. These platforms cater exclusively to specific clubs, allowing fans to connect like never before.
Many fans appreciate the authenticity and community feel these media outlets foster. They create a sense of belonging that larger, general sports networks often lack.
- Fans engage with content that reflects their passions.
- There’s a deeper understanding of the club’s culture and history.
- These platforms often feature fan-generated content, enhancing community involvement.
This fan-centric approach is compelling and offers a fresh alternative to mainstream coverage.
Community Engagement Like Never Before
One of the standout features of one-club fan media is its ability to foster community engagement. Fans are not just passive consumers; they actively participate in discussions, share their views, and even contribute content.
By encouraging open dialogue, these platforms create a vibrant ecosystem. Fans can:
- Share match reactions in real-time.
- Discuss tactics and player performances.
- Organize meet-ups and events for supporters.
This engagement leads to a more dynamic and collaborative atmosphere. Fans feel valued and heard, which strengthens their connection to the club.
Unique Insights From Die-Hard Supporters
Unlike mainstream sports journalism, one-club fan media often features insights from die-hard supporters. These contributors bring a wealth of knowledge that is hard to find elsewhere.
Their passionate observations provide a unique angle on matches and club developments. Fans get to learn about:
- Lesser-known players and their contributions.
- Historical context behind certain decisions or games.
- Personal anecdotes that reflect the club’s spirit.
This depth of coverage elevates the quality of football news and helps fans feel more informed and connected.
